How Low-E Solar Control Glass Works
Low-E Solar Control Glass works by applying a microscopically thin, transparent coating that reflects heat while allowing light to pass through. The Low-E coating reduces the amount of infrared and ultraviolet light that comes through the glass without compromising the amount of visible light transmitted. This combined technology ensures optimal thermal insulation and effective solar heat control, making it an ideal choice for various applications.
Advantages of Low-E Solar Control Glass
Energy Efficiency
Low-E Solar Control Glass significantly reduces heating and cooling costs by maintaining a consistent indoor temperature. The solar control properties help in minimising the need for air conditioning during summer and heating during winter, leading to substantial energy savings.
Enhanced Comfort
This glass type offers superior comfort by reducing glare and protecting interiors from harmful UV rays. The Low-E coating helps in maintaining a pleasant indoor environment, contributing to overall well-being.
Environmental Benefits
By using Low-E Solar Control Glass, you contribute to a lower carbon footprint and promote sustainable building practices. The energy-efficient properties of this glass type support eco-friendly construction and renovation projects.

Performance Metrics and Standards
Low-E Solar Control Glass meets high-performance metrics, including:
- Thermal Performance (U-Value): Excellent thermal insulation properties.
-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C): Effective solar heat control.
- Visible Light Transmittance (VLT): High levels of natural light transmission. Our products comply with all relevant building regulations and standards, ensuring top-notch quality and performance.
